Exxon Mobil Corporation (NYSE:XOM) Q2 Pointing to Flat Profits

Exxon Mobil Corporation (NYSE:XOM) said lower natural gas and chemical margins in its second quarter would offset improved crude and refining operations, pointing to flat profits sequentially and down from a year-earlier. The U.S. oil major said in a securities filing it expected improved crude prices to boost second-quarter profit by $400 million to $600 million. However, natural gas NGc1 prices which have dropped to multi-year lows in the face of tepid demand, were expected to offset it by an equal measure.
